According to The Hollywood Reporter, Baby Boom](Baby Boom (1987) - Movie | Moviefone) and Alfie](Alfie (2004) - Movie | Moviefone) (2004) director Charles Shyer has signed on to direct a chick flick. Shyer will be behind the lens for the tale of two best friends (BFF, for the acronym-challenged, means best friends forever in girlspeak) who have reunited as adults, only to find one is a country mouse and one is a well-heeled city gal. The script was originally written by Vanessa Parise and Robin Dunne and is now being rewritten by Ellen Greenberg and Hallie Shyer, who is currently co-writing the screenplay for *Eloise in Paris *along with Charles Shyer, who will also direct.
